Calfic Syrup

  • Composition

    Each 15 ml contains
    Ferrous Glucconate BP 300mg
    Calcium Glucconate BP 125mg
    Cyanoccobalamin BP 10mg
    Folic Acid BP 2mg
    Sorbitol Bp q.s

    In a flavoured syrup base
    Colour: Carmoisine
    Appropriate overages of vitamins added to compensate loss on storage.

    MECHANISM OF ACTION
    Calfic is an important activator in many enzymatic reactions and is essential to a number of physiologic processes including transmission of nerve impulses; contraction of cardic, smooth and skeletal muscles; renal function; respiration and blood coagulation. Calfic also plays regulatory roles in the release and storage of neurotransmitters and hormones, in the uptake and binding of amino acids, and in cyanocobalamin (Vitamin B12) absorption and gastric secretion. Calfic syrup contains folic acid which works along with vitamin B12 and vitamin C to help the body break down, use and in creation of new protein

  • INDICATION...

    Calfic suspension contains Iron which is important for the production of red blood cells. It is used to treat conditions arising from calcium deficiencies such as hypocalcemic tetany, hypocalcemia related to hypoparathyrodism and hypocalcemia due to rapid growth or pregnancy. Also used as an adjunct in the treatment of rickets & osteomalacia. It also helps tissues growth in the maintenence of a healthy nervous system and contains an especially important vitamin for maintaining healthy nerve cells.

    Calfic works to promote normal growth and development, helps in the management of certain types of nerve damage, and treats permicious anemia.

    DRUG INTERACTIONS: Interactions with Calfic may occur with the following:

    • Antacid
    • Levodopa (Dopar, Larodopa)
    • Quinolone antibiotics (Cipro, Floxin)

    SIDE EFFECTS:

    • Side effects may include
    • Constipation, diarrhea
    • Stomac pain, upset stomach;
    • Black or dark-colored stools or urine; or
    • Temporary staining of the teeth.

    STORAGE: Stores in a cool, dry & dark place. Protect from sunlight.
    PRESENTATION: 100/200ml in Pet bottles and in Duplex Board cartons
